Prince Harry says he would 'like to get my father back, I would like to have my brother back' in a preview clip from a forthcoming interview.
Prince Harry is planning to launch a "nuclear strike" with the Prince and Princess of Wales his intended target, a leading Royal expert has claimed.
The Duke of Sussex says “I would like to get my father back, I would like to have my brother back” in a preview clip from a forthcoming interview.
The 90-minute programme will broadcast two days before Harry’s autobiography Spare is published on January 10.
Rafe Heydel-Mankoo spoke out after a clip of the new TV interview Prince Harry has given showed him saying he desperately wanted his father and brother back.

Rafe told GB News: “He says he wants to have his father and his brother back. I don't know what charm school he's been to. But I think if you did go to one, How to Win Friends and Influence People wasn't on his reading list.
“His memoir, the Netflix documentary. I mean, the reality is, we saw the King deliver that wonderfully warm speech in which he named check Harry and Megan building their lives overseas. We saw his brother Prince William, the Prince of Wales and the Princess of Wales, extending an olive branch after the Queen died by inviting them to join them as Fab Four once again to view the flowers laid at Windsor Castle for their grandmother. And what was their response to these two olive branches?

“There was a hope that there might be a perfect chance for reconciliation, the death of a family member bringing people closer together, the accession of the King setting their minds to something more important than their California grievances. Instead, they launched a nuclear strike on the royal family with a Netflix documentary, and it seems now as if we're going to get another nuclear strike albeit this one targeted more specifically on Prince William and Kate and perhaps on Camilla.”
On any hopes of a reconciliation, he continued: “I think any reconciliation is now kicked far into the long grass. What I got from the Netflix documentary and other appearances over the past few months is that increasingly, we have clear evidence that Harry is merely the mouthpiece for Megan. He's never been the brightest bulb on the Christmas tree, but she's a very savvy manipulator and I think you can really see that she's the puppet master or dare I say even the ventriloquist here.”
